Re: Schedule of binNMUs for hdf5 transition



On Fri, Mar 17, 2006 at 03:18:00PM +0100, Josselin Mouette wrote:
> Now that HDF5 1.6.5 has been accepted, the following packages require a
> rebuild. As no changes to source should be required, is it possible to
> schedule a set of binary NMUs for them as soon as hdf5 itself is
> rebuilt?

> octave2.9
> octave2.1
> statdataml
> semidef-oct
> mpb
> kmatplot
> tessa
> pytables

BinNMUs have been queued for all of these.

> octplot
> plplot

These two are one day away from being candidates for testing, so I'll wait
until after dinstall tomorrow to queue the binNMUs.

> octave-forge

This one is tied into the netcdf transition that we've been waiting on for a
while, so I'm pushing up the timeline on that transition before rebuilding
octave-forge in order to keep the two transitions separate.
